Konami announced on Sunday that as part of the 25th anniversary celebrations of the Yu-Gi-Oh! Trading Card Game, they will release the Yu-Gi-Oh! Early Days Collection for Nintendo Switch and PC via the Steam platform.

The collection will feature several previously released titles from the Yu-Gi-Oh! series, including Yu-Gi-Oh! Duel Monsters 4: Saikyō Duelist Senki (Yu-Gi-Oh! Duel Monsters 4: Battle of Great Duelists) and Yu-Gi-Oh! Duel Monsters 6 Expert 2. Konami will announce the remaining titles in the collection at a later date.

Yu-Gi-Oh! Duel Monsters 4: Saikyō Duelist Senki was released by Konami in 2001 for the Game Boy Color and never made it to the English-language market. On the other hand, Yu-Gi-Oh! Duel Monsters 6 Expert 2 was modified and released later in North America under the title Yu-Gi-Oh! Worldwide Edition: Stairway to the Destined Duel for the Game Boy Advance.

Konami Digital Entertainment recently announced the establishment of their own animation studio, KONAMI Animation. The studio made its debut with a short film called “Yu-Gi-Oh! Card Game The Chronicles” to commemorate the 25th anniversary of the game.
